We are recruitng a Design Engineer / Drafter for our client who specialise in turning shipping containers into functional, creative and bespoke spaces (Industrial/Commercial and Residential).
With a large in-house production facility and recent investment in direct sales and marketing capability, we are looking for the right individual to support Container Conversion team with design, and technical drawings to suit our customers varied requirements and specification.
Key responsibilities
To draft general assembly layouts & plans for client approval using AutoCAD and Inventor.
To specify project requirements to component and subcomponent level, source parts and compile bills of materials when necessary.
To complete full technical Fabrication / Lining and Electrical layout production drawings
To compile technical/product support documentation (Datasheets /COSH/ Manuals) when required.
To support/advise any involved in-house or sub-contractor staff to support delivery of the projects (electrical, mechanical, civils trades).
To attend customer sites to meet with clients, suppliers or subcontractors as required.
To assist with compiling technical documentation for tender submissions.
About you
Experience using AutoCAD, Autodesk Inventor ideally in ISO container fabrication.
Engineering or other relevant education.
Ability to produce, read & understand technical manufacturing drawings.
Proven record of accomplishment in drafting and DTM – Design to Manufacture.
Excellent IT skills (Microsoft Excel, Word, Outlook).
Its great, but not required, if you have:
Metal fabrication or construction industry knowledge or qualification in Mechanical Engineering.
Knowledge of H&S requirements in a construction or fabrication environment.
Knowledge of Building Regulations.
Project support or Project management experience.
Exposure to modular construction techniques.
Knowledge of electrical and/or plumbing systems
